How to sue a clinic for medical malpractice
Medical malpractice
A simple blood collection sample resulted in the incapacity of performing my daily work routine. The medical technician who collected the sample refused to admit that she has actually pricked me with a needle, and the Doctor and Clinic Manager is backing the medical technician's story.
I have a bruise on the jab area on my arm which verifies that the actual pricking of the needle has been carried out.

In regards to your inquiry, the first thing you should do is to bring that issue to the MOH and request a medical report from them.
They will do the needful and later you will have what enables you to claim damages against the whole entity, the CEO, the head manager, and the nurse who could be your respondents in a civil lawsuit which is 100% claimable since you suffered damages behind such medical malpractice.

To start with, you should submit a complaint to the ministry of health and get a medical report from the coroner.
However, you should in parallel, file a case against them and claim compensation for material and moral damages.
